Six people have been confirmed dead after a shooting in the Czech Republic.

Security has been heightened all over the Czech Republic following a shooting at University Hospital in Ostrava. The identity of the victims have not yet been released, nor has the motive behind the attack. An arrest has been made, although it is not yet clear whether or not it was the shooter who had been detained by police. According to a number of reports, the shooting took place at a traumatology clinic in the hospital at approximately 7am local time. "We are currently strengthening the supervision of selected soft targets across the Czech Republic", tweeted a Czech Republic Police account. Andrej Babis, the prime minister has also cancelled his day's schedule to go to the hospital. Universities and other businesses in the area have closed down for the day.
